Ukrainian drones spark fire at oil refinery, says Russia

Ukraine’s overnight drones launched at Russia sparked a fire at the Iisky oil refinery in the southern city of Krasnodar, local Russian officials said on Sunday.

“One of the processing units caught fire. The blaze, covering several square meters, was quickly extinguished,” the officials wrote on the Telegram messaging app. 

They reported no casualties and added that fire and resue teams were working on site.

Russia’s overnight drone attacks injure several across Ukraine

A series of Russian strikes across Ukraine overnight left at least one person dead and several others injured, Ukrainian officials reported.

In Kyiv, falling debris from downed drones started fires on top of a 16-story residential building and two nine-story buildings, according to Mayor Vitali Klitschko.

At least eight people, including a pregnant woman, were injured, and an elderly woman was killed. Three of the injured were hospitalized.

According to Reuters, witnesses heard a series of explosions shaking the Ukrainian capital city, which they believe were air defense units conducting operations.

Explosions were also reported in the cities of Odesa, Kharkiv, Dnipro, Zaporizhzhia, and Kryvyi Rih.

Poland, which is Ukraine’s neighbor to the west, scrambled its fighter jets during Russia’s air raid to protect its own air space.

Russia currently occupies about 20% of Ukraine’s territory. Meanwhile, diplomatic efforts to reach a ceasefire and achieve lasting peace have stalled.

Welcome to our coverage

Russia’s war in Ukraine continues to rage on with reports of overnight drone attacks from both the countries.

Ukrainian officials reported dozens of injuries from overnight strikes, emphasizing that its neighbor continues to deliberately target civilian areas.

Despite US President Donald Trump’s initial efforts to promote peace, Russia’s ongoing attacks on civilians have hindered progress.

Meanwhile, several of Ukraine’s European allies, led by France, have pledged troops for a postwar security force. Germany is still considering its options.
